Our property

Ca' Marcello is situated in a peaceful and convenient location, right in the heart of the Veneto countryside, between Oriago and Malcontenta, within the Mira area. Just 2 km from the famous Villa Foscari designed by Palladio, it serves as the perfect starting point to explore Venice and its surroundings while still enjoying the tranquility of nature. Reaching Venice is easy: there is a bus stop only 900 meters from the property, or you can take the vaporetto from Fusina, which is just 8 km away. We offer rooms and apartments to meet various needs. The double rooms come in different sizes, all featuring private bathrooms, air conditioning, heating, and Wi-Fi. One of the rooms can also accommodate a third single bed. The two-room apartments consist of a double bedroom, a bathroom, and a kitchen/living area, with the option to add a third bed. The three-room apartments include a double bedroom, a room with bunk beds, a bathroom, and a kitchen/living area. All apartments are equipped with air conditioning, heating, and Wi-Fi. Extra beds must always be arranged in advance. The property is surrounded by greenery, featuring a lovely tree-lined avenue that stretches from one end to the other, a lavender field, and a vegetable garden. For those looking to relax or spend time outdoors, there is a summer pool with a solarium, bicycles, two-person kayaks, ping pong, foosball, and a play area for children. Our breakfast

Every morning, you can enjoy breakfast in the comfort of your room, in complete privacy and relaxation. Breakfast is available upon request and is not included in the room rate. While we do not have a dedicated breakfast room, each room is equipped with a table, chairs, cups, glasses, cutlery, and a refrigerator, allowing guests to enjoy breakfast comfortably in their room. The size of the table may vary depending on the room. A shared area serving three rooms is also available and includes a coffee, tea, chamomile, and barley coffee machine, a microwave oven, and a kettle. Our breakfast basket includes rusks, jams, hazelnut spread, honey, biscuits, milk, plain or fruit yogurt, butter, apples (or other seasonal fruit), and freshly baked croissants or pastries every morning (with of fillings and flavors). Depending on availability and upon request, sliced cheese and fresh bread may also be provided. Please let us know in advance about any dietary requirements or special requests. Ca' Marcello is a family farm with deep roots in this land. The original building dates back to the 1700s and has been part of this corner of the Venetian countryside for over three centuries. In the early 1900s, Silvio Manfrin, the grandfather of the current owner, bought the house and started a grocery shop and a small tavern, very popular with the barges — the "burci" — that travelled up and down the Brenta between Padua and Venice. In the 1960s, with the construction of the Romea road, river traffic came to an end and the house remained unused for a long time. In 1996 the family decided to restore it and open the agritourism, betting on an extraordinary place: a stone's throw from Venice, overlooking the Brenta Naviglio, in an oasis of peace and quiet. The land surrounding the property has always been cultivated and still is today. In spring we harvest asparagus and artichokes, in summer tomatoes, courgettes, aubergines and peppers, and in autumn pumpkins. Since 2023 we have also added a lavender field, which we invite you to visit especially during the flowering season. Today Ca' Marcello is managed by Fabiana, who has been coordinating the property since 2023, with the support of her mother Ornella and her father Silvio — always around and always ready to share stories and memories of someone who was born and grew up right here. The grandchildren Gaia, Giulia, Edoardo, Ilaria and Iris are often seen around the property too: Ca' Marcello is, above all, a family home.

Area countryside

Ca' Marcello is in a strategic position: in the heart of the Riviera del Brenta, just a few kilometres from Venice, but with the whole of Veneto within easy reach. Guests who choose to stay here often discover that Venice is just one of the many things to see and do. The first stop is the Riviera del Brenta itself, which starts practically on the doorstep. The Palladian villas overlooking the Naviglio, the well-kept gardens, the small villages like Oriago and Dolo: everything can be explored by bike, by car or on a cruise along the Brenta. Half an hour away by car is Chioggia, the charming lagoon town that many people don't know, with its fish market, canals and a unique curiosity: the bell tower of the Church of Sant'Andrea is home to the oldest clock in the world. Padua deserves at least a full day: the Scrovegni Chapel with Giotto's frescoes, the Basilica of Sant'Antonio, the lively squares and the atmosphere of one of Italy's oldest university cities. Around Padua you'll find the Euganean Hills, with villages like Arquà Petrarca, the thermal spas of Abano and Montegrotto, and walled towns like Montagnana — whose walls are among the best preserved in the world. Heading north, another chapter opens: Treviso, a city of water crossed by the Sile river; the Prosecco hills; and then Vicenza, the Palladian city par excellence, with the Olympic Theatre and Villa La Rotonda. Those who love medieval villages will be spoilt for choice: Cittadella and Castelfranco Veneto with their intact walls, Marostica with its famous chess square, Bassano del Grappa with its wooden bridge over the Brenta, and finally Asolo, the "city of a hundred horizons", from which on clear days you can see both the Dolomites and Venice. In short, you can spend a whole week without ever getting bored — and without necessarily setting foot in the lagoon.
